Hong Li is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Electrical and Electronic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Hong Li has authored 255 papers receiving a total of 3.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 62 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 62 papers in Materials Chemistry and 27 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ering. Recurrent topics in Hong Li's work include Polymer Surface Interaction Studies (15 papers), Advanced Polymer Synthesis and Characterization (14 papers) and Metallurgical Processes and Thermodynamics (13 papers). Hong Li is often cited by papers focused on Polymer Surface Interaction Studies (15 papers), Advanced Polymer Synthesis and Characterization (14 papers) and Metallurgical Processes and Thermodynamics (13 papers). Hong Li coll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and United Kingdom. Hong Li's co-authors include Miaoquan Li, Liquan Chen, Meng‐Bo Luo, Xiaohui Rong, Yong‐Sheng Hu, Yaxiang Lu, Yongming Zhang, J. David Robertson, Weixin Yu and Chao Zhang and has published in prestigious journals such as Angewandte Chemie International Edition, The Journal of Chemical Physics and S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ología.
